Benchmarks

STM32

MCU

Flash Size [kB]

Interface

Autoprogram [s]

Write[s]

Read [s]

Programming speed [kB/s]

Read speed [kB/s]

MCU

Flash Size [kB]

Interface

Autoprogram [s]

Write[s]

Read [s]

Programming speed [kB/s]

Read speed [kB/s]

STM32H7A3G

1024

USB DFU

9.7

5.8

3.1

175

325

STM32L462CE

512

USB DFU

8.4

6.9

0.8

73

667

STM32U585ZI

2048

USB DFU

27.8

20.4

6.3

100

322

STM32L552ZE

512

USB DFU

8.8

6,8

1.2

75

418

STM32H733ZG

1024

USB DFU

14.1

6.1

3.4

169

371

Note:

  • Autoprogram time –> Interface initialization, Erase, Program and Verify (Flash only)

  • Write time –> Interface initialization, Program (Flash only)

  • Read time –> Interface initialization, Read (Flash only)

  • Programming speed – Whole flash programming speed without interface initialization

  • Read speed – Flash reading speed without interface initialization